:root{--mksv-purple:#8222ee;--mksv-indigo:#5b2cff;--mksv-blue:#1673ff;--mksv-ink:#18152a;--mksv-muted:#6f6885;--mksv-border:#e8e4f5;--mksv-bg:#fbf9ff;--mksv-good:#0f8f5f;--mksv-bad:#c92a2a}
.mks-verbal-lesson,.mks-sc-lesson,.mks-rc-lesson,.mks-cr-lesson{color:var(--mksv-ink);line-height:1.65}
.mks-verbal-layout-compact{max-width:980px;margin:0 auto}
.mks-verbal-hero{padding:28px;margin:22px 0;border-radius:22px;background:linear-gradient(135deg,rgba(130,34,238,.12),rgba(22,115,255,.1));border:1px solid var(--mksv-border)}
.mks-verbal-hero h1{margin:10px 0;font-size:clamp(28px,4vw,46px);line-height:1.08}
.mks-verbal-hero p,.mks-verbal-muted{color:var(--mksv-muted)}
.mks-verbal-badge,.mks-sc-badge,.mks-rc-badge,.mks-cr-badge{display:inline-flex;padding:7px 12px;border-radius:999px;color:#fff;font-weight:800;letter-spacing:.04em;font-size:12px;background:linear-gradient(90deg,var(--mksv-purple),var(--mksv-indigo),var(--mksv-blue))}
.mks-verbal-section{background:#fff;border:1px solid var(--mksv-border);border-radius:20px;padding:24px;margin:22px 0;box-shadow:0 10px 28px rgba(30,20,80,.04)}
.mks-verbal-table-wrap{overflow-x:auto;margin:16px 0}.mks-verbal-table{width:100%;border-collapse:collapse;min-width:680px}.mks-verbal-table th,.mks-verbal-table td{border:1px solid var(--mksv-border);padding:10px 12px;vertical-align:top}.mks-verbal-table th{background:#f4efff;font-weight:800}
.mks-verbal-question-card,.mks-sc-question-card,.mks-rc-question-card,.mks-cr-question-card,[data-mks-verbal-question]{background:#fff;border:1px solid var(--mksv-border);border-radius:18px;padding:20px;margin:20px 0;box-shadow:0 8px 22px rgba(30,20,80,.035)}
.mks-verbal-question-meta{display:flex;flex-wrap:wrap;gap:8px;margin-bottom:12px}.mks-verbal-chip{display:inline-flex;padding:5px 9px;border-radius:999px;background:#f3edff;color:var(--mksv-purple);font-size:12px;font-weight:800}
.mks-verbal-stem{margin:12px 0}.mks-sc-underlined,.mks-verbal-underlined{text-decoration:underline;text-decoration-thickness:2px;text-decoration-color:var(--mksv-purple);text-underline-offset:3px}
.mks-verbal-option-list{display:grid;gap:10px;margin:16px 0}.mks-verbal-option-list label{display:block;padding:12px 14px;border:1px solid var(--mksv-border);border-radius:14px;background:#fff;cursor:pointer}.mks-verbal-option-list label:hover{border-color:var(--mksv-purple);background:#fbf9ff}
.mks-verbal-tools{display:flex;flex-wrap:wrap;gap:10px;margin:16px 0 0}.mks-verbal-btn{border:0;border-radius:13px;padding:11px 16px;font-weight:800;background:linear-gradient(90deg,var(--mksv-purple),var(--mksv-blue));color:#fff;cursor:pointer}.mks-verbal-btn.secondary{background:#f3edff;color:var(--mksv-purple)}
.mks-verbal-feedback{margin-top:12px;padding:12px 14px;border-radius:14px;font-weight:800}.mks-verbal-feedback.correct{background:rgba(15,143,95,.12);color:var(--mksv-good);border:1px solid rgba(15,143,95,.25)}.mks-verbal-feedback.incorrect{background:rgba(201,42,42,.1);color:var(--mksv-bad);border:1px solid rgba(201,42,42,.22)}
.mks-verbal-explanation{display:none;margin-top:14px;padding:14px;border-radius:15px;background:#fbf9ff;border:1px solid var(--mksv-border)}.is-checked>.mks-verbal-explanation{display:block}
.mks-verbal-test-box{border:2px solid rgba(130,34,238,.18);border-radius:22px;padding:18px;margin:24px 0;background:linear-gradient(180deg,#fff,#fbf9ff)}.mks-verbal-test-bar{position:sticky;top:0;z-index:10;display:flex;justify-content:space-between;gap:12px;align-items:center;padding:13px 15px;margin:-18px -18px 18px;border-radius:20px 20px 0 0;background:#18152a;color:#fff}.mks-verbal-timer{font-variant-numeric:tabular-nums;font-weight:900}
.mks-verbal-msr,.mks-rc-passage-box,.mks-sc-rule-box{border:1px solid var(--mksv-border);border-radius:18px;overflow:hidden;margin:18px 0;background:#fff}.mks-verbal-tab-list{display:flex;flex-wrap:wrap;gap:6px;padding:10px;background:#f4efff}.mks-verbal-tab{border:1px solid var(--mksv-border);background:#fff;border-radius:999px;padding:8px 12px;font-weight:800;cursor:pointer}.mks-verbal-tab.active{color:#fff;border-color:transparent;background:linear-gradient(90deg,var(--mksv-purple),var(--mksv-blue))}.mks-verbal-panel{display:none;padding:18px}.mks-verbal-panel.active{display:block}
.mks-verbal-yn-grid,.mks-verbal-tpa-grid{overflow-x:auto;margin:16px 0}.mks-verbal-yn-grid table,.mks-verbal-tpa-grid table{border-collapse:collapse;width:100%;min-width:620px}.mks-verbal-yn-grid th,.mks-verbal-yn-grid td,.mks-verbal-tpa-grid th,.mks-verbal-tpa-grid td{border:1px solid var(--mksv-border);padding:10px 12px;text-align:left}.mks-verbal-yn-grid th,.mks-verbal-tpa-grid th{background:#f4efff}
.mks-verbal-dashboard-widget{background:#fff;border:1px solid var(--mksv-border);border-radius:22px;padding:22px;margin:22px 0;box-shadow:0 10px 28px rgba(30,20,80,.04)}.mks-verbal-stat-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(160px,1fr));gap:12px;margin:16px 0}.mks-verbal-stat{border:1px solid var(--mksv-border);border-radius:16px;padding:14px;background:#fbf9ff}.mks-verbal-stat strong{display:block;font-size:28px;line-height:1.1;color:var(--mksv-purple)}.mks-verbal-mini-list{display:grid;gap:10px}.mks-verbal-mini-item{border:1px solid var(--mksv-border);border-radius:14px;padding:12px;background:#fff}
@media(max-width:640px){.mks-verbal-section,.mks-verbal-hero{padding:18px}.mks-verbal-test-bar{position:static;flex-direction:column;align-items:flex-start}.mks-verbal-btn{width:100%}}
